Prostacyclin receptor

UniProt P43119 Organism Homo sapiens Gene PRIPR, PTGIR

Also known as: PRIPR, PTGIR

Function

Receptor for prostacyclin (prostaglandin I2 or PGI2). The activity of this receptor is mediated by G(s) proteins which activate adenylate cyclase.
